  • When the VFR 750 was first released in 1986 and throughout its period of manufacture until the end of 1997 it remained head and shoulders the best all round sports touring motorcycle that money could buy. Over 25 years later, I believe a clean VFR 750 is still the best bang for your buck. They're so cheap nowadays that sellers are practically giving them away. You'd be daft not to buy one and experience it at least once in your life. They set a high standard against which all other motorcycles can be judged and rarely achieve.

    I have had a 97 model since 2017 and have now covered 27k miles since I got it.
    I love the long distance comfort, the +220 mile tank range, the engine which can be a low revving relaxed tourer or a screaming banshee at the top end of the rev range.
    The down sides are that the original Honda rectifiers fry themselves, the exhaust collector box under the engine rusts through, but both are easily replaced with after market kit. Apart from that they are wonderfully reliable bikes with a remarkable quality of finish.
    As you noted, the weight is a problem at low speed and the 25 year old plastic bodywork cracks easily if you drop it.
    I love the rock steady handling. It's not flickable like a modern sports bike but it swoops through the twisty roads with great speed and grace.

    Hi bud myself have 3 vfrs one same as yours in red a 1988 fj model last vfr 1200f ridden every model my view is they are all good a tip for you wire rectifier direct to the battery and hard wire all plugs from the stator its the plugs that rot which causes bad charging faults done both mine also take rear shocker linkage apart and grease all the link pins my self hgv mechanic so do all my own repairs . Both off mine have stainless steel exhaust systems fitted carbs to set up are easy like you said these vfrs were built to last had most sport touring bikes but always come back to the honda.
